Creating a playlist in iTunes

Playlists are great ways of having selected tracks to play at any given time. For example, you could have a playlist for the car with all your favourite sing along tunes, and other set of tracks for when you go to the gym. These are known as playlists, in a nut shell!

Not only can you have a selection of songs, but also audiobooks, videos, even podcasts – set to play in a partilar order of your choosing.

Playlists can be created on your PC and when you next plugin your , they will appear under the ‘Playlists’ option on the main menu. It’s so easy!

To make a playlist of your own

  1. In iTunes choose File > New Playlist > Type a name for the playlist i.e. ‘Gym’ or ‘Drive time’, etc. (the new playlist will appear on the left-hand side menu).
  2. Go back to your music library by clicking ‘Music’ from the left-hand menu and just simply drop-and-drag tracks to your playlist name on the left.

Tips

  • To select multiple items, hold down the Control or Shift key on your keyboard whilst you click – saves time if you want multiple items selected.
  • To remove an item from a playlist, select the playlist name on the left-hand menu > select the track in the list shown in the main menu and press the Delete key (this does not remove the item from your library or hard disk).
